Transaction 21ff5702f40dda9ee7341f91ec14fc795a43a44951b566359038c2f181f56909
1 Input
1 Output
-
21ff5702f40dda9ee7341f91ec14fc795a43a44951b566359038c2f181f56909:0
- value
- 29035
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2ecc782cc5588eb8cd457d54d96a91c813bdd66 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LEGZ15STeaCbWJc1Pt7M54QEFLMBF4Ujb